Borrowing Books from the List

To borrow one of the books from the Staff Recommendations list, click on the title link, which will take you to the library catalog. Once you are there, click on the "Request" button at the top of the page (pictured below):

Hold this item

Requesting a book requires that you be registered for a My Library account.

Once you have requested the book, it will be made available for you through our No-Touch Circulation system (click to read more).

While most of the books listed below are from MU Libraries' own collection, others are not, but they can still be requested from our partner libraries through our EZ-Borrow and Interlibrary Loan (ILL) services. These are both free to use if you are a Marshall student, faculty, or staff member!

  • To search for an item using EZ-Borrow, click here to log in with your MU username and password. Once you are logged in, use the Simple Search bar (or the Advanced Search at the top right) to locate an item by title, keyword, author, etc. 
    • Click on items you are interested in on the list of results to display more information.
    • If you want to request an item, click under "Select Pickup Location" and choose either "Drinko Library Circulation Desk" to pick up your item at the Huntington campus or "Graduate College General Collection" to pick it up at the South Charleston campus.
    • Once requested, most EZ-Borrow items take between 3-5 business days to arrive. (You will receive an e-mail letting you know when it is available to pick up.)
    • If the item is not requestable via EZ-Borrow, the system will display a link allowing you to make an Interlibrary Loan request.
  • If no libraries have the item you want through EZ-Borrow, you can request it through Interlibrary Loan.
    • To use Interlibrary Loan, you will need to register for an IDS Express account (click the link to register).
    • Once you have registered for an account, find the link for the type of item (book, article, music recording, etc.) you want to borrow and provide as much information as you can to help lending staff locate your item.
    • Interlibrary Loan requests are generally not as fast as EZ-Borrow, because they are often coming from farther away. Allow at least 5-15 days for them to arrive.
